II. Succulents suitable for home cultivation

1. Peach Beauty

Peach Beauty is a popular variety of succulent, truly unique with its thick stems and round leaves that everyone admires. It readily fills a pot, developing into a beautiful, mature plant. The leaves also have a white bloom, indicating its sun tolerance.

2. Mingyue

'Mingyue' is a classic, common succulent with slender, attractive leaves. It grows rapidly and develops a beautiful, jelly-like color that everyone admires. Its robust stems make it excellent for cultivating into a mature, woody plant, which is very charming. Even beginners can successfully grow it.

3. Swift Constellation

This succulent is truly excellent. It has a classic rosette shape, grows rapidly, and readily produces new heads. The plant is compact, and its bright red leaves give it a very stylish look. However, it requires careful watering; overwatering can lead to waterlogging and root rot.

4. Jin Huangxing

Most people are familiar with this type of succulent. Its leaves have beautiful fuzz and a bright red color. The stems are thick and sturdy, and when grown into a beautiful little old-growth, everyone who sees it will praise its uniqueness. Be sure to give it plenty of sunlight and avoid watering the leaves, as this will severely affect its appearance and make it look unsightly.

5. White chrysanthemum

Most people are familiar with Echeveria 'White Chrysanthemum', a type of succulent with a thick white bloom on its leaves, giving it an ethereal and beautiful appearance. It grows rapidly. Echeveria 'White Chrysanthemum' is very easy to achieve its best color and appearance. This succulent grows quickly and easily fills its pot. It is recommended to give it plenty of sunlight, which will make the leaves redder and more attractive.

6. A beautiful woman in pink

When it comes to succulents that are easy to color, the Pink Lady is definitely a must-mention. This succulent looks very beautiful, grows rapidly, has pink leaves, is highly resistant to disease, is very sun-tolerant, and is easy to grow into a mature plant. You don't have to worry about pests or diseases at all.
